WebRather, you need to decide how much of the property you want to own in terms of shares and then pay a portion of the share. So for a property of £300,000 you decide that you want to buy a 25% share on the property. All you’ll need is 5% of the share ready as a deposit. So 25% of £300,000 is £75,000. And 5% of that is £3,750.

WebThe ‘estimated total monthly cost’ for a Shared Ownership property consists of three separate elements added together: rent, service charge and mortgage. Read More Read Less Rent: This is charged on the share you do not own and is usually payable to a housing association (rent is not generally payable on shared equity schemes).
